One of our frequently asked questions from customers is: " What is Red Fife?"
Our answer:" It is a heritage grain and Canada's oldest wheat."
The modern hard red spring wheat of today, which is planted Canada wide and exported, was parented by Red Fife. It came to Canada from Ukraine, via Scotland, back in the 1840s and has an amazing history. Today, it is making a comeback with bakers. And it should. This special wheat has a natural sweetness paired with subtle undertones of earth, and has the same qualities as the modern hard red spring wheat.
